I was trying to find out how to use "Java Live Errors".
I went to the documentation, in help index I searched "live error" and double clicked on "Java Live Errors".
The docs here say that I should do Build->Java Options.
However there is no "Java Options" item in the Build menu.
If I go to Tools->Options->Languages->Application Languages->Java
I see "Compiler Properties", but I don't see anywhere here to enable Live Errors.
If I search for "live" in the tools->options search text, there are no hits.
-
You have to have a Java project open in order for there to be a Build->Java Options menu item.
